#a68302 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a68302 is composed of 65.1% red, 51.4%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.1% magenta, 98.8%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 47.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 32.9%. #a68302 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ff04 with #4d0700.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#a68302 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a68302 has RGB values of R:166, G:131,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.99,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10912514.

Shades and Tints of #a68302
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0900 is the darkest color, while #fffd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a68302
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585750 is the less saturated color, while #a68302 is the most saturated one.
